Arsenal are reportedly ‘tracking’ RB Leipzig goalkeeper Peter Gulacsi.

Arsenal are said to be keeping an eye on Gulacsi.

According to ESPN, the Gunners, as well as Chelsea, were scouting the 27-year-old goalkeeper during Leipzig’s 2-0 defeat to Bayern Munich on Saturday.

The Gunners are reportedly hoping to make the shot-stopper Petr Cech’s replacement. The 35-year-old has under two years left on his current deal and, let’s be honest, he was never supposed to be a long-term solution. Therefore, it does seem pretty clear that Arsene Wenger is at the very least in the market for a new pair of safe hands.

Whether he’s genuinely interested in the Leipzig man, however, is another matter.

Gulacsi failed to make a single senior appearance during the entire five years he was at Liverpool (2008-2013).

The Hungarian was instead sent out on various loan spells to Hereford United, Tranmere Rovers and Hull City to gain first team experience. However, in the end, Liverpool let him leave and he joined Red Bull Salzburg on a free in 2013.

Gulacsi has until 2020 on his contract with Leipzig, who he joined in 2015, and he’s made 63 appearances for the Bundesliga team. In that time, he’s kept just 15 clean sheets, which is only one more than Wojciech Szczesny kept last season alone, and he’s shipped 75 goals.

He may not have the best stats but if it’s between Gulacsi and David Ospina, having some fresh blood in the side might be nice.
